Welcome to the Farelight pricing experiment. As a contractor you'll work only in the shadow environment, where the ticket-pricing model runs against mirrored traffic from the Bramwick venue cluster. Never promote variants yourself; the experiment council reviews every change. Daily snapshots of the pricing config are encrypted at rest, and restoring one requires two approvals. When you perform your first supervised restore, decrypt the snapshot archive using the recovery passphrase provided below.

unlock words, hahip-fahag: sordor-druath

Welcome to maintaining TideGlance, the tide-table widget for the Harborline dashboard. It pulls predictions from the Seabreak service hourly and caches them locally. If the cache store ever locks you out, you'll need to restore access to the admin vault. Use the recovery passphrase below to unlock it.

unlock words, kajef-kadug: sorys-pelax-lamael-tamvan-briiel-novdor-fenwyn-tamdor-oliion-keleth-julok-belion-ralok

Handover: Veldrane config hot-reload (Tomas → Priya)

The Veldrane gateway watches its config file via inotify and applies changes without restart. Reload events are logged with a checksum of the new file; failed parses keep the previous config active. Note for review: secrets are reloaded along with everything else, so there is no separation between sensitive and non-sensitive keys yet. Rate limits and TLS settings take effect within two seconds. For the audit, the current production values as loaded at last reload are as follows.

settings of fafog-haduf:
ZORIX_PIN=4648
ZORIX_METRICS_HOST=metrics.zorix.paliqsys.corp
ZORIX_LOG_LEVEL=info
ZORIX_TENANT=druix

Handover Note — Budget Request, Pellwick Services

To branch managers, from outgoing director Theo Marsh to incoming director Ines Farrow: the pending capital request for the Greyholt depot upgrade is with the finance committee. Supporting figures are complete; only the contingency line needs revision before resubmission. Ines will own this from Monday. The confidential note below covers the related expansion plan.

internal memo for kawip-hadug: Headcount on the Wenwyn team goes from 7 to 140 by the end of January. Gross margin on Wenwyn came in at 20 percent against a plan of 15 percent.